如何查看Redis中的缓存数据(怎么查看缓存redis)
Redis是一款高性能的key-value内存数据库,它通常被用作高效的数据库、Cache、队列、聊天室等。它的数据库包括五种数据类型:字符串(String)、列表(List)、哈希(Hash)、集合(Set)和有序集合(ZSet),同时还支持慢查询(Slow log)、事务(Transaction)、延迟消息(Delay message)、压缩容器(Bitmap)等特性。
在Redis中,可以通过指令管理缓存,例如在字符串中设置或获取缓存,或者在列表中添加或删除缓存等。要查看Redis中的缓存数据,可以使用以下几种方法:
第一种方法是使用Redis指令进行查看,通常有两个命令:KEYS和SCAN。KEYS指令可以获取当前Redis中的所有缓存Key,而SCAN命令可以获取当前Redis的数据值。例如,可以使用以下Redis指令获取Redis中所有字符串缓存的Key和值:
127.0.0.1:6379> KEYS *
127.0.0.1:6379> SCAN 0 MATCH *
第二种方法是使用Redis客户端,如Redis Desktop Manager,它提供了一个可视化的界面,可以方便地浏览Redis缓存中的数据。此外,还有一些Redis客户端带有性能分析器,可以监控和分析Redis中的数据,如何使用和避免缓存雪崩等等。
如果需要以编程方式查看Redis缓存,可以使用Redis客户端库。它提供了多种丰富的API来访问Redis中的缓存,如通过使用 Redis-py 等python库来读取和写入操作,即可轻松访问Redis中的缓存内容。
可以使用多种方法来查看Redis中的缓存数据。正确的方法是根据具体的使用场景和需求,结合上述指令和Redis客户端来查看缓存中的数据,以获得更好的性能和体验。
相关文章